3. Moz Local
Moz Local is dedicated to helping businesses manage their local listings and improve their online visibility. It simplifies the process of submitting and updating business information across various online directories.
Description:
Moz Local focuses on listing management and citation building. Its primary function is to help businesses ensure their information is consistent across all relevant directories, improving their chances of ranking higher in local search results. It also tracks the performance of listings.
Pros:
- Listing Distribution: Makes it easy to submit and manage listings.
- Citation Management: Helps build and optimize citations.
- Reputation Management: Monitors and manages online reviews.
Cons:
- Limited Features: Lacks some of the more advanced features of comprehensive SEO platforms.
- Pricing: Pricing can be a consideration, especially for the features offered.
Who it's Best For:
Moz Local is ideal for small to medium-sized businesses that want a straightforward tool to manage their local listings and citations. It is also good for businesses prioritising citation management.

6. Yext
Yext is a listing management platform that focuses on ensuring data accuracy across various online directories. It is focused on centralized listing management, offering a robust solution for businesses wanting consistent data across the web.
Description:
Yext offers a robust platform for managing business listings across a vast network of online directories. Its key feature is its ability to update a business's information in real-time across numerous platforms, which guarantees data consistency.
Pros:
- Listing Management: Excellent listing data management capabilities.
- Data Synchronization: Fast data synchronization across numerous platforms.
- Scalability: Suited for businesses of all sizes, including large enterprises.
Cons:
- Pricing: A higher cost compared to other local SEO tools.
- Limited Features: More focused on listing management.
Who it's Best For:
Yext is best suited for larger enterprises and businesses that need to manage a substantial presence across many directories and platforms. It is also suitable for businesses that prioritize consistent data.

How does listing management help with local SEO?
Optimizing and maintaining your business listings (citations) across various online directories is essential for local SEO. Consistent and accurate information across all listings helps search engines understand and verify your business's details, resulting in higher rankings.
What is citation building, and why is it important in local SEO?
Citation building involves creating mentions of your business on other websites, such as business directories, industry-specific sites, and local websites. Citations help to establish your business's online presence and boost credibility with search engines, which impacts your local SEO.
How can I monitor and respond to online reviews with a local SEO tool?
Local SEO tools often include review monitoring features. These features allow you to track new reviews, receive notifications, and respond to both positive and negative feedback efficiently. Effective review management enhances your reputation and increases customer trust.
